PRODYNA focuses on customer experience, by designing, implementing, and operating custom software applications for mid to large size enterprises. We are committed to offering our customers innovative and future-proof solutions, through digitalisation and cloud computing strategies. As a member of Cloud Native Computing Foundation (CNCF), PRODYNA promotes speed, agility, and scalability in software development.
A few words about you working with us
We are about to expand our dev team in PRODYNA Greece ! We are looking for a skilled developer to join our team, which consistently raises the bar on innovation, customer experience and technical services. If you are NOT a “ninja”, “macho” or “rockstar” developer but a Software Engineer, continue reading this.
Requirements
We are seeking an experienced Software Engineer with a strong focus on React and a background in building scalable, high-performance web applications. The ideal candidate will have at least 4 years of hands-on experience with React, with a deep understanding of front-end development and related technologies. Familiarity with Python is a plus, especially in developing back-end services and APIs. This role offers the opportunity to work on innovative projects, contributing to the development of cutting-edge solutions for our clients.
Your daily tasks
- Design, develop, and maintain robust, scalable web applications using React.
- Collaborate with cross-functional teams including designers, product managers, and backend engineers to deliver high-quality products.
- Optimize components for maximum performance across a vast array of web-capable devices and browsers.
- Ensure that front-end code is well-structured, reusable, and follows best practices.
- Work closely with backend engineers to integrate APIs and develop seamless user experiences.
- Participate in code reviews, debugging, and issue resolution to ensure the highest standards of quality.
- Stay updated with the latest industry trends and technologies, contributing to continuous improvement of the development process.
Requirements
- 4+ years of professional experience with React and modern JavaScript (ES6+).
- Strong proficiency in HTML5, CSS3, and JavaScript (including frameworks/libraries like Redux, TypeScript, etc.).
- Experience with RESTful APIs and integrating front-end with back-end services.
- Knowledge of build tools and bundlers (e.g., Webpack, Babel, npm).
- Experience with version control systems (e.g., Git).
- Strong problem-solving skills and attention to detail.
- Excellent communication and collaboration skills.
Benefits
Compensation & Perks
- Salary: We will settle on the exact compensation amount based on prior experience and skills.
- Private health insurance & Life Insurance from day #1
- Health management scheme (weekly sessions &monthly challenges)
- 25 vacation days
- Team events tech oriented and more
- International network
- Lunch in the office & Go For Eat vouchers
- Employee referral programme/ bonus
Dedicated budget for:
- Employee education ~ 800€
- Hardware selection (MacBook or Lenovo ThinkPad) with your own mobile ~ 3000€